PROPERTY FROM THE COLLECTION OF JAMES E. BREECE, III
1798
A PAIR OF BLUE AND WHITE BOTTLE VASES
KANGXI PERIOD (1662-1722)
Each vase is decorated on the bulbous body with three shaped panels enclosing insects fying around
blossoming trees and shrubs growing beside rocks, all reserved on a stylized foral ground. The neck is
further decorated with lappets.
10º in. (26.1 cm.) high
(2)
$7,000-10,000
PROVENANCE
Chait Galleries, New York (according to labels).
